Unlike decibels (dB), which are logarithmic and measure sound pressure level, a sone is a linear unit of perceived loudness. One sone is arbitrarily defined as the loudness of a 1,000 Hz tone at 40 dB above the listener's threshold of hearing. A sound of 2 sones is perceived as twice as loud as 1 sone.
